Cabbage Tree

Prep Time: 60 Minutes
Cook Time: 0 Minutes
Ready In: 60 Minutes
Servings: 10

You can actually just take the idea and make up your own tree. Just put things that you like on it.
Ingredients:
2 large green cabbage
200 frilly toothpicks
25 cheddar cheese cubes (1 inch cubes)
25 monterey jack cheese cubes (1 inch cubes)
25 large stuffed green olives
25 cherry tomatoes
25 pieces dill pickles (1 inch chunks)
25 small cocktail onions
25 radishes, cleaned and trimmed
25 pieces sweet pickles (1 inch chunks)
Directions:
1. Cut the cheddar cheese, jack cheese, sweet pickles, and dill pickles into 1-inch cubes.
2. Using the frilly toothpicks, push each piece of appetizer onto the frilly toothpick.
3. Next, push each toothpick into the cabbage, making sure that the cubes of food stay on the toothpick.
4. You can make this up ahead of time, just keep it refrigerated.
5. The toothpicks can be removed, rinsed and cooked.
6. Note: Be careful if giving this appetizer to a small child. A child can get a toothpick caught in their throats, especially when running.
